It seems that Google are going into even more markets, first we had Google Earth, then we had Google Sky and now we have the launch of their newest add-on Google Flight Simulator. What makes all these updates even better is the fact that they are free.
Some people will not have heard of this update and therefore will not know how to use the Flight Simulator, all you need to do is press Ctrl+Alt+A to get things started. Once the add-on starts up you will have the choice to fly two planes either an F16 or a SR22 which is a four-seater plane. What makes these update even better is the fact that it has full joystick support and the fact that you can save how far you get.
